CHRIS BOTTI – A NEW VOLUME

Grammy winning trumpeter CHRIS BOTTI has announced the release of a new album – his first in over a decade and his first for the iconic Blue Note label – hence its title, ‘Vol.1’.

Previews reveal that the long players is an intimate, small group project which delivers a mix of acoustic jazz and classic standards. Amongst the familiar standards are emotive versions of ‘Bewitched, Bothered and Bewildered’, ‘My Funny Valentine’, ‘Someday My Prince Will Come’ and a mournful ‘Danny Boy’ which opens proceedings and sets the tone for the remaining nine tracks.

The album’s  biggest surprise, maybe, is a cover of Cold Play’s ‘Fix You’ while the set’s big vocal moment is a bossa nova flavoured ‘Paris’ featuring up and coming vocalist John Splithoff. Other featured players include violinist Joshua Bell, pianist Taylor Eigsti, guitarist Gilad Hekselman, and drummer Vinnie Colaiuta. Production is   down to garlanded David Foster – so smooth jazz quality guarantted.

Of the album, Botti says: “I turned 60 in 2022, at a time that seemed like a restart for so many things in the world. I  wanted to strip away all the orchestral arrangements and focus more on my playing, the playing of my band, and these jazz classics that we always love playing on stage.”

CHRIS BOTTI ; ‘Vol 1’ out October 20th via Blue Note
